Suburb snapshot

Hastings (Vic.) is a mid-sized suburb in the Mornington Peninsula area, home to around 10,369 residents (2021 Census). Available data shows 1,689 offences in 2026 with relatively stable year-on-year trends (-4%), roughly 162.9 offences per 1,000 residents, 4 school and preschool sites in the area, strong public transport coverage with many Public Transport Victoria stops, many local shops, services and recreation venues, and notable planning and development activity on record. Snapshot data also shows parks or public open space within the suburb and hospitals or GP clinics within the suburb.
